1. The Right Type for Your Lifestyle
Refrigerators come in numerous configurations, each dealing with various family sizes and storage habits:
- Single Door: Best for bachelors or little households with limited space.
- Double Door (Top/Bottom Freezer): The most popular option for mid-sized households; offers much better organization and larger freezer capacities.
- Side-by-Side: Ideal for large households who purchase wholesale and appreciate high-end visual appeal.
- French Door: Combines the finest of both worlds with a broad fridge compartment on leading and a pull-out freezer drawer listed below, using remarkable storage versatility.
2. Capacity: How Much Space Do You Need?
Capability is determined in liters (L). Choosing the wrong size can lead to lost energy (if too big) or food wasting (if too small).

4. Necessary Features to Look For
Modern refrigerators are loaded with technology designed to simplify life. Keep an eye out for these functions:
- Inverter Compressors: These instantly change speed based upon cooling need, leading to silent operation and lower power consumption.
- Frost-Free Technology: Eliminates the requirement for manual defrosting, preventing ice accumulation.
- Convertible Modes: Allows you to change a freezer area into a fridge area, offering additional space throughout social gatherings or holidays.
- Water and Ice Dispensers: A practical luxury, though setup requires a dedicated water line connection.
Determining Your Space: The Golden Rule
Among the most common mistakes when purchasing online is stopping working to determine the designated area. Follow these actions to prevent a delivery headache:
- Width, Depth, and Height: Measure the exact area where the fridge will sit.
- Clearance Space: Add at least 2-- 3 inches on all sides for correct ventilation. Without this, the compressor will overheat, leading to decreased effectiveness and bad cooling.
- Entryway Clearance: Measure your doorways, hallways, and stairs to ensure the delivery group can actually get the fridge into your kitchen.

- Inspect the Warranty: Ensure you comprehend what is covered under the maker's guarantee. Lots of online sellers offer extended warranty programs; weigh the cost against the peace of mind.
- Confirm Delivery and Installation: Confirm whether the service consists of "white glove" installation (bringing it within, unboxing, and setting it up). Some sellers only offer curbside delivery.
- Check Out the Return Policy: Given the size of the product, comprehend the retailer's policy relating to damage throughout transit or dead-on-arrival (DOA) units.
- Try to find "Open Box" Deals: If you are on a spending plan, some sellers offer display systems or returned items that are completely functional but come at a substantial discount.
